New museum leaders told the Board of Commissioners they reorganized, have a plan to improve transparency and asked for a two-year lease so they can demonstrate operational improvements. After extended Q&A, the board agreed to add the museum lease request to tomorrow's agenda for a vote.

The Old Courthouse Museum's new leadership asked the Douglas County Board of Commissioners on May 4 for a two-year lease so the nonprofit can implement reforms, expand school tours and pursue fundraising partnerships.

Frank Frank, who introduced himself as a museum board presenter, said the newly constituted board had reorganized leadership, would provide quarterly and annual financial reports and open its books to county review. "We are here to ask for a new lease," Frank said, urging commissioners to put a two-year agreement on the next day's agenda so the board could show progress.
